Description

A great game for spelling practice! The play is simple: spread your twelve cards (2 1/8 x 3 3/8) out, make as many words as possible, count your score, and replenish your cards from the draw pile. When the draw pile is gone, the game is over and the winner is the one with the most points. While play moves a little slowly, it's great practice in building words. More "wordy players can play the Blast version each player has 50 cards and makes as many words as possible in five minutes. Other variations provide for team play (to accommodate larger groups) or for very beginning readers (only use certain cards). 300 cards total; for 2-6 players/teams.
